Our Team

The Enterprise Programs team was formed to ensure projects and programs that span across the company have comprehensive structure and completed in a timely manner.

The Role

We are looking for a Junior Program Manager to aid the Enterprise Program team to reach their goals on time, in scope and on budget. Our perfect candidate has an interest in Software Project management, can handle multiple projects for the business at any given time, and has a passion for organization, process, and customer success. This position will involve oversee the coordination of the process of introducing a new product to the market, coordinating various teams like marketing, sales, and development to execute a comprehensive launch strategy, including market research, messaging development, promotional campaigns, and distribution planning, with the goal of achieving successful product adoption and sales targets.

As an Enterprise Program Manager you will

Guide teams in delivery planning, including definition of scope and success, timeframes/milestones, risks, RACI, dependencies, and alignment with company objectives

Execute projects with a bias towards incremental / iterative delivery of value and adaptation based on regular stakeholder feedback and assessment of external conditions

Manage expectations and keep communication flowing for stakeholders

Tracking and reporting on project velocity, progress, and outcomes

Build a trusting and safe environment within teams where problems can be raised without fear of blame, retribution, or being judged, with an emphasis on healing and problem-solving

Measure team performance and team health using appropriate tools and techniques and use information to support ongoing process improvements, team member engagement, and sustainable pace

We are excited if you have (Required Experience):

Strong communication skills and experience interacting with individuals across departments at all levels, and varying backgrounds and nationalities

Experience with the Agile framework and balancing between iterative engineering development and senior leadership’s need for clear timelines and milestones

Good skills and knowledge of servant leadership, listening & observing, facilitation, situational awareness, conflict resolution, continual improvement, team building, problem-solving, coaching, empowerment, and increasing transparency.

Bsc/BA in related field or equivalent experience

You may also have

Experience managing programs across an enterprise related projects
